Frequently Asked Questions

  • What are the best places to stay in Palaiokastritsa?

    Stays around the main bay, village center, and hillside areas are often recommended for scenic views and easy access to beaches. Many accommodations blend traditional architecture with inviting outdoor spaces. Family-friendly and quiet retreats are also found near olive groves.

  • What are the best things to do in Palaiokastritsa with kids?

    Families often enjoy safe swimming beaches, boat rides to nearby caves, and gentle walking paths. The local aquarium introduces children to regional marine life, and there are shaded picnic spots perfect for a relaxing afternoon.

  • What are some of the best things to do in Palaiokastritsa?

    Swim or snorkel in clear waters, visit the historic monastery, and join a boat tour exploring sea caves. Walking trails, relaxed seaside dining, and hillside viewpoints round out the experience.

  • How is the weather in Palaiokastritsa?

    Palaiokastritsa has mild, rainy winters around 46–56°F (8–14°C), and warm, drier summers near 73–85°F (23–30°C). Light breezes and occasional showers are common outside summer, so layers can be useful.

  • When is the best time to visit Palaiokastritsa?

    Late spring and early autumn are often recommended for milder temperatures, quieter beaches, and beautiful natural scenery. Summer months have the warmest weather and lively seaside activity, while winter tends to be quieter with more rain.

  • What are the best places to visit in Palaiokastritsa?

    Guests frequently explore the Palaiokastritsa Monastery, swim at main beaches, and take boat trips to blue sea caves. The aquarium and hillside villages like Lakones invite deeper local discovery.

  • What are some local tips for visiting Palaiokastritsa?

    Locals often suggest exploring in the early morning or late afternoon to avoid peak sun, especially in summer. Consider comfortable water shoes for the pebbly beaches, and try a small taverna for locally rooted specialties. Snorkeling around hidden coves is frequently suggested.

  • What is Palaiokastritsa known for?

    Palaiokastritsa is known for its clear blue bays, lush green hillsides, and impressive sea caves. The hilltop monastery draws visitors interested in local history and panoramic views, while beaches are frequently suggested for swimming and snorkeling.

  • What are the best hidden gems to explore in Palaiokastritsa?

    Small, less-frequented coves around the coastline invite quiet swims and picnics. Hidden chapels and olive groves provide a peaceful setting for walks, and traditional bakeries tucked in the village are known for their pastries.

  • What are the best foods to try in Palaiokastritsa?

    Local tavernas often serve dishes such as sofrito, pastitsada, and fresh seafood, alongside seasonal salads and olive oil-based recipes. Bakery sweets, including local honey-soaked pastries, are frequently suggested.
